Field Service Engineer
at FieldAI
About the Role
As a Field Service Engineer , you will be a key technical link between FieldAI’s robotics platform, our customers, and our engineering team. You will help ensure FieldAI’s robotic fleet operates reliably in customer environments while turning field observations into actionable feedback for product and engineering teams.
This is a highly practical, customer-facing role with a balanced mix of mechanical/electrical repair, software-based troubleshooting, and operational support..
What You Will Do
-
Bring up new robots upon receipt from OEMs or manufacturing partners, including initial configuration, quality checks, calibration, and software provisioning.
-
Monitor and maintain fleet health across deployed assets, ensuring robots are tracked, serviced, and maintained according to FieldAI standards.
-
Manage inbound and outbound logistics requests from internal teams, including robot shipments, spare parts, tools, and field-service equipment.
-
Coordinate with operations, engineering, deployment, and customer-facing teams to ensure equipment is prepared, packed, shipped, received, tracked, and documented accurately.
-
Diagnose, replace, and configure hardware components, including sensors, actuators, compute modules, batteries, wiring harnesses, and electromechanical subsystems.
-
Perform field diagnostics and root cause analysis to resolve hardware, software, networking, and system-level issues.
-
Travel to customer sites to lead robot installations, perform repairs, execute upgrades, calibrate systems, and support production deployments.
-
Maintain clear and structured service logs, diagnostic records, configuration changes, asset movements, shipment status, and field observations.
-
Partner with Field Application Engineers and engineering teams to deploy software updates, reproduce issues, escalate bugs, and share technical feedback from the field.
-
Support continuous improvement of service procedures, logistics workflows, technical manuals, troubleshooting guides, and internal documentation.
-
Operate safely and professionally in industrial, construction, and customer production environments.
Core Skills & Qualifications
-
2+ years of experience in technical field service, robotics, hardware support, industrial automation, or a related hands-on technical role.
-
Strong mechanical and electrical troubleshooting skills, including comfort working with tools, wiring, sensors, actuators, and robotic subsystems.
-
Ability to read and interpret wiring diagrams, schematics, assembly drawings, and service documentation.
-
Proficiency with Linux command line tools, SSH-based remote troubleshooting, and basic shell scripting.
-
Comfortable diagnosing issues across hardware, software, networking, and system configuration layers.
-
Strong communication and customer-facing skills, with the ability to explain technical issues clearly and professionally.
-
Ability and willingness to travel regularly, approximately 30–50%.
-
Comfortable working in industrial, warehouse, construction, or production environments.
-
Experience coordinating logistics, inventory movement, shipping/receiving, RMAs, or service parts workflows in a hardware, robotics, or field operations environment.
Nice to Have (Not Required)
-
Experience with autonomous mobile robots, AMRs, industrial robotics, drones, or other autonomous systems.
-
Familiarity with ROS, Python, robotics middleware, or scripting for diagnostic and automation workflows.
-
Experience using tools such as Jira, remote monitoring dashboards, or fleet management systems.
-
Familiarity with safety practices and compliance requirements in production, construction, or industrial environments.
-
Experience supporting customer deployments from installation through ongoing production operations.
